You said in principal I should be able to extract a potential of mean force from an AFM run by simply integrating the average force along the reaction coordinate and if I have the average force as a function of position, I could simply integrate that to get the PMF. However, actually, i don't

I didn't say that.  The post I pointed you to did :)

know how i can get the average force as a function of position and apply them in the PMF calculation. Could you give me some suggestion?

Your .pdo file should have the forces, if I remember the old (3.3.x, right?) file format correctly. Then something like g_traj can extract coordinates from your trajectory. Also a good reference (and there is a ton of stuff in the list archive about this, hint):

http://www.gromacs.org/pipermail/gmx-users/2002-August/002241.html

I've not tried to do PMF analysis this way. It is much easier under 4.0 now to use umbrella sampling since g_wham now works. It was non-functional (or buggy at best) in previous versions.
